Our First Car!
Calgary is like a small town in a "big" city. Everything is very spread out and far away from eachother, getting places and running everyday errands, like grocery shopping, becomes a chore that takes twice as long as it should. For the past 5 months we have managed getting places using Calgary Transit. It's been tolerable since the weather has been great! But....it's starting to snow and the average temperature these days is -5 and getting colder {brrrr}. We really wanted to cut our errand time down to a minimum, avoid taking taxis home and get out of the city to enjoy the mountains in the winter whenever we want!...So this past Monday we purchased a Jeep Patriot!*

Since moving into our apartment I have really embraced the decorating experience. I've found myself wondering into home store that I would never have gone into prior to us moving here. I've loved being able to envision an idea and create and style our apartment the way we want it. I have slo become obsessed with candles. I find them an easy way to add ambiance and style to a room, while adding subtle and refreshing scents.
Bath & Body Works carries a home fragrance line called Slatkin & Co. They make great smelling products at really affordable prices. And since it is sold at Bath & Body works you can count on amazing sales and promotions! {I recently purchased two 14.5oz candles for $25}. Personally, I only purchase the candles {I feel air fresheners are too over-powering for the size of our aparatment} but all air fresheners are available in the same scents as the candles and are also frequently on sale. There are so many unique scents to choose from {here}, especially during the holiday months. My favorites are S'more and Cranberry Pear Bellini for everyday use, Winter and Tis' The Season for the holidays!
The larger 14.5oz candles are three-wicked and burn approximatley 40-65 hours! The smaller 4oz candles have one wick and will last approximately 25-40 hours! What I also like about these candles is they actually but for that amount of time. {I recently purchased a Glade candle that stated a 60 hours burn time and lasted maybe 15}. Each candle is created exclusivley by Harry Slatkin and Home Frangrance Experts and use a blend of begetable wax and lead-free wicks to optimize the life of the candle.
You can puchase these candles and other Slatkin & Co products exclusivley at Bath & Body Works!*
